58624abf5f Improve nova statedir ownership logic
The nova_compute container kolla config is currently set to recursively change
the ownership of /var/lib/nova to nova:nova on startup.

This is necessary when upgrading from an non-container deployment to a
containerized deployment as the nova uids are not consistent across the host
and container image.

If the nova instancedir is an NFS mount then open filehandles are
broken and every VM using that NFS export fails with I/O errors.

This change re-implements the nova statedir ownership logic to target only the
files/directories controlled by nova.

4e24c8cb6a Sample environment generator
This is a tool to automate the generation of our sample environment
files.  It takes a yaml file as input, and based on the environments
defined in that file generates a number of sample environment files
from the parameters in the Heat templates.  A tox genconfig target
is added that mirrors how the other OpenStack services generate
their sample config files.

A description of the available options for the input file is
provided in a README file in the sample-env-generator directory.

In this commit only a single sample config is provided as a basic
example of how the tool works, but subsequent commits will add
more generated sample configs.
